Arces (), commonly identified under the name Arces-sur-Gironde, is a commune in the Charente-Maritime department in southwestern France.
The small village is situated on the fringes of the côte de Beauté, closely connected with the nearby capital of the Royan hinterland canton, Cozes, which hosts the area's largest concentration of businesses and commerce.
